//! Compatibility wrappers that bridge BitTorrent, magnet, and Metalink models.
|
|
#![forbid(unsafe_code)]
|
|
|
|
use std::fmt::{Display, Formatter};
|
|
|
|
use crate::{
|
|
magnet::{MagnetUriModel, parse_magnet_uri},
|
|
metalink::{MetalinkDocumentModel, parse_metalink_document},
|
|
torrent::{TorrentMetadataModel, parse_torrent_metadata},
|
|
};
|
|
|
|
/// Declares how far a protocol family has progressed in the current implementation.
|
|
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
|
|
pub enum ProtocolSupportState {
|
|
/// The protocol is known but not yet wired into the workspace.
|
|
Planned,
|
|
/// Parsing and model registration exist, but transfer execution is pending.
|
|
Registered,
|
|
/// A compatibility skeleton is present and exposes the public API shape.
|
|
Skeleton,
|
|
}
|
|
|
|
/// Summarizes protocol readiness across BitTorrent-adjacent inputs.
|
|
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
|
|
pub struct ProtocolSupportMatrix {
|
|
/// Current state of `.torrent` metadata handling.
|
|
pub bit_torrent: ProtocolSupportState,
|
|
/// Current state of magnet URI handling.
|
|
pub magnet: ProtocolSupportState,
|
|
/// Current state of Metalink XML handling.
|
|
pub metalink: ProtocolSupportState,
|
|
}
|
|
|
|
/// Returns the current protocol support matrix exposed by this compatibility layer.
|
|
#[must_use]
|
|
pub const fn protocol_support_matrix() -> ProtocolSupportMatrix {
|
|
ProtocolSupportMatrix {
|
|
bit_torrent: ProtocolSupportState::Skeleton,
|
|
magnet: ProtocolSupportState::Registered,
|
|
metalink: ProtocolSupportState::Registered,
|
|
}
|
|
}
|
|
|
|
/// Compatibility wrapper for parsed magnet URI metadata.
|
|
#[derive(Debug, Clone, PartialEq, Eq)]
|
|
pub struct MagnetUri {
|
|
/// Parsed BTIH info hash.
|
|
pub info_hash: String,
|
|
/// Optional display name from the `dn` query field.
|
|
pub display_name: Option<String>,
|
|
/// Ordered tracker URLs from `tr` query fields.
|
|
pub trackers: Vec<String>,
|
|
/// Ordered web-seed URLs from `ws` query fields.
|
|
pub web_seeds: Vec<String>,
|
|
}
|
|
|
|
/// Compatibility wrapper for parsed Metalink documents.
|
|
#[derive(Debug, Clone, PartialEq, Eq)]
|
|
pub struct MetalinkDocument {
|
|
/// Root element name used for diagnostics.
|
|
pub root_element: String,
|
|
/// Parser state describing whether a real model was produced.
|
|
pub status: ParserStatus,
|
|
/// Parsed Metalink document model when parsing succeeded.
|
|
pub document: Option<MetalinkDocumentModel>,
|
|
}
|
|
|
|
/// Records whether a compatibility parser stayed stubbed or produced a model.
|
|
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
|
|
pub enum ParserStatus {
|
|
/// Parsing support is registered but no real model was built.
|
|
RegisteredStub,
|
|
/// Parsing produced a protocol-layer document model.
|
|
ParsedModel,
|
|
}
|
|
|
|
/// Errors raised while converting BitTorrent-adjacent formats into compatibility models.
|
|
#[derive(Debug, Clone, PartialEq, Eq)]
|
|
pub enum BtMetalinkError {
|
|
/// The magnet URI was malformed.
|
|
InvalidMagnet {
|
|
/// Parser-specific explanation of the magnet failure.
|
|
reason: String,
|
|
},
|
|
/// The requested torrent feature is not yet implemented.
|
|
UnsupportedTorrentBinary,
|
|
/// The Metalink document was malformed or unsupported.
|
|
InvalidMetalink {
|
|
/// Parser-specific explanation of the Metalink failure.
|
|
reason: String,
|
|
},
|
|
}
|
|
|
|
impl Display for BtMetalinkError {
|
|
fn fmt(&self, f: &mut Formatter<'_>) -> std::fmt::Result {
|
|
match self {
|
|
Self::InvalidMagnet { reason } => write!(f, "invalid magnet: {reason}"),
|
|
Self::UnsupportedTorrentBinary => {
|
|
f.write_str("torrent binary parsing is not implemented")
|
|
}
|
|
Self::InvalidMetalink { reason } => write!(f, "invalid metalink: {reason}"),
|
|
}
|
|
}
|
|
}
|
|
|
|
impl std::error::Error for BtMetalinkError {}
|
|
|
|
impl MagnetUri {
|
|
/// Builds the compatibility wrapper from the protocol-layer model.
|
|
#[must_use]
|
|
pub fn from_model(model: MagnetUriModel) -> Self {
|
|
Self {
|
|
info_hash: model.info_hash,
|
|
display_name: model.display_name,
|
|
trackers: model.trackers,
|
|
web_seeds: model.web_seeds,
|
|
}
|
|
}
|
|
|
|
/// Parses a magnet URI into the compatibility skeleton.
|
|
///
|
|
/// # Errors
|
|
///
|
|
/// Returns an error when the `magnet:?` prefix is missing or the URI does
|
|
/// not contain an `xt=urn:btih:<hash>` value.
|
|
pub fn parse(input: &str) -> Result<Self, BtMetalinkError> {
|
|
parse_magnet_uri(input).map(Self::from_model)
|
|
}
|
|
}
|
|
|
|
impl MetalinkDocument {
|
|
/// Builds the compatibility wrapper from the protocol-layer Metalink model.
|
|
#[must_use]
|
|
pub fn from_model(model: MetalinkDocumentModel) -> Self {
|
|
Self {
|
|
root_element: "metalink".to_owned(),
|
|
status: ParserStatus::ParsedModel,
|
|
document: Some(model),
|
|
}
|
|
}
|
|
|
|
/// Parses Metalink XML text through the protocol-layer Metalink parser.
|
|
///
|
|
/// # Errors
|
|
///
|
|
/// Returns an error when the input is not a valid Metalink document or
|
|
/// when the document has no actionable resources.
|
|
pub fn parse(input: &str) -> Result<Self, BtMetalinkError> {
|
|
let document = parse_metalink_document(input)
|
|
.map_err(|reason| BtMetalinkError::InvalidMetalink { reason })?;
|
|
|
|
Ok(Self {
|
|
root_element: "metalink".to_owned(),
|
|
status: ParserStatus::ParsedModel,
|
|
document: Some(document),
|
|
})
|
|
}
|
|
}
|
|
|
|
/// Compatibility wrapper for parsed torrent metadata.
|
|
#[derive(Debug, Clone, PartialEq, Eq)]
|
|
pub struct TorrentMetadata {
|
|
/// Parsed torrent metadata model.
|
|
pub model: TorrentMetadataModel,
|
|
}
|
|
|
|
/// Errors raised while parsing `.torrent` metadata.
|
|
#[derive(Debug, Clone, PartialEq, Eq)]
|
|
pub enum TorrentMetadataError {
|
|
/// The torrent payload was syntactically invalid.
|
|
Invalid {
|
|
/// Parser-specific explanation of the torrent failure.
|
|
reason: String,
|
|
},
|
|
/// The payload used an unsupported feature.
|
|
Unsupported {
|
|
/// Name of the unsupported torrent feature.
|
|
feature: &'static str,
|
|
},
|
|
}
|
|
|
|
impl Display for TorrentMetadataError {
|
|
fn fmt(&self, f: &mut Formatter<'_>) -> std::fmt::Result {
|
|
match self {
|
|
Self::Invalid { reason } => write!(f, "invalid torrent metadata: {reason}"),
|
|
Self::Unsupported { feature } => write!(f, "{feature} is not implemented"),
|
|
}
|
|
}
|
|
}
|
|
|
|
impl std::error::Error for TorrentMetadataError {}
|
|
|
|
impl TorrentMetadata {
|
|
/// Wraps a protocol-layer torrent model.
|
|
#[must_use]
|
|
pub fn from_model(model: TorrentMetadataModel) -> Self {
|
|
Self { model }
|
|
}
|
|
|
|
/// Returns a shared reference to the underlying torrent metadata model.
|
|
#[must_use]
|
|
pub fn as_model(&self) -> &TorrentMetadataModel {
|
|
&self.model
|
|
}
|
|
|
|
/// Consumes the wrapper and returns the underlying torrent metadata model.
|
|
#[must_use]
|
|
pub fn into_model(self) -> TorrentMetadataModel {
|
|
self.model
|
|
}
|
|
|
|
/// Parses torrent binary metadata through the shared protocol-layer parser.
|
|
///
|
|
/// # Errors
|
|
///
|
|
/// Returns a structured invalid-metadata error when the payload cannot be parsed.
|
|
pub fn parse(input: &[u8]) -> Result<Self, TorrentMetadataError> {
|
|
parse_torrent_metadata(input)
|
|
.map(Self::from_model)
|
|
.map_err(|error| TorrentMetadataError::Invalid { reason: error })
|
|
}
|
|
}
